Director of the CDC Tom Frieden is featured in the centerfold of the print campaign. In an exclusive piece, he provides insight on how to prevent healthcare acquired infections (HAI) and superbugs. At any one time, 1 in 25 hospital patients gets at least one HAI. Many of these infections are resistant to at least one of the drugs commonly used to treat them. Many of the most urgent and serious drug-resistant threats are health care-associated infections.
